ORA-08004 错误详解 1. ORA-08004错误的含义 ORA-08004 是一个 Oracle 数据库错误,指出 Oracle 数据库无法实例化序列。实例化是指将数据库序列视为对象并给它一个当前值。该错误通常表示尝试获取的序列值超出了其定义的最大值(MAXVALUE)或低于其定义的最小值(MINVALUE)。 2. ORA-08004错误可能的产生原因 超出...
sequence如果没有设置循环cycle,在超过了sequence的最大值后,将出现ORA-08004错误。 在达到了sequenc的最大值后,如果设置了循环cycle,sequence的初始值将从minvalue开始,而不是设置的start with 值。
INCREMENTBY1--每次加1个按1增加MAXVALUE49999--最大值是499999CYCLE--循环,递增到499999后从1开始NOCACHE;
解决序列最小值ORA-08004错误,ALTERSEQUENCE序列名称INCREMENTBY1--每次加1个按1增加MAXVALUE49999--最大值是499999CYCLE--循环,递增到499999后从1开始NOCACHE;...
ORA-08004: sequence SEQ_T_CUSTOMER_ID.NEXTVAL exceeds MAXVALUE and Caused by: java.sql.SQLException: ORA-08004: sequence SEQ_T_CUSTOMER_ID.NEXTVAL exceeds MAXVALUE and alter sequence SEQ_T_CUSTOMER_ID nomaxvalue;
ORA-08004:序列XX无法实例化 错误说明:下一个序列值超过序列配置的最大值 ORA-08102: 未找到索引关键字, 对象号 2852155, 文件 9, 块 1544794 (2) 错误说明:我遇到的情况是用B表的字段更新A表的字段,A表中复合索引由A1、A2、A3 三个字段组成,更新只涉及A3字段,Oracle自动去找 ORA-08176:一致读取失败;回退...
Oracle Materials Requirement Planning - Version 11.5.10.2 and later: ORA-08004: Sequence MRP_FORECAST_DATES_S.NEXTVAL Exceeds Maxvalue & Discussion on ORA-00001 Avoi
Caused by: java.sql.SQLException: ORA-08004: sequence SEQ_T_CUSTOMER_ID.NEXTVAL exceeds MAXVALUE and alter sequence SEQ_T_CUSTOMER_ID nomaxvalue;
Oracle Database - Enterprise Edition - Version 10.2.0.1 and later: ORA-08004 sequence DBMS_LOCK_ID.NEXTVAL exceeds MAXVALUE and cannot be instantiated
ORA-08004 序列号超出了MAXVALUE的值,并且不能实例化该序列 已经用完了给定序列中所有可用的序列号。可以选择用来删除和重新创建序列。可以使用ALTER SEQUENCE命令为序列增大MAXVALUE的设置值;或者使用ALTER SEQUENCE CYCLE来允许索引循环。 ORA-02287 该位置不允许使用序列号 试图在SQL中不允许使用序列的位置上使用序列。